Explanation:
External recruitment is the process of announcing vacancies to the people outside ones organization while Internal recruitment is the process of announcing vacancies for the internal staffs only.
The process of external recruitment is usually longer and more expensive than internal recruitment. For example, payment to publish the vacancies in any national newspapers or payment for outsourcing company that specializes in recruitment.
